  • How many songs can you put in an Ipod touch 64GB if you only use it for music?

    I've heard the Ipod classic 160GB is discontinued. Could someone tell me how many songs you can put in the Ipod touch 64GB if you exclusively use it for music and don't put any photos, videos or anything?

    I just did some quick figuring. There are a lot of variables. My 64gb 5th gen touch has only 56.6gb capacity so says the unit. Settings>General>About.
    MP3 formatted songs vary greatly. I quickly perused my collection and found that the size varied from 3-7MB per song. Using the average of 4MB per song,(7MB is a rather large file for MP3) you will come up with 56.6 X 1024MB (1024 MB per 1GB) =57958MB/4 =14489 songs. This will probably never happen as there is cover artwork and different variables because of file size to consider. This gives you an Idea where to start.

  • I bought a song and an album on my iPod touch last night..

    So last night I bought a song and an album on my iPod touch and when I synced it to my computer none of the songs transferred to my PC and now the songs are gone from my iPod touch. The only thing left is the audiobooklet. So how can I get the songs back?? And the songs aren't showing up as purchased on my iPod touch.
    If this makes any sense PLEASE help me (:

    Look in your purchase history to see if it shows as purchased. If not, then just purchase again.
    If it does show as purchased then try:
    In itunes click Store>Check for Available Downloads and see if it shows up.
    If not, try attaching the ipod and, in itunes, click File>Transfer Purchases.
    If these do not work, the go to purchase history and click "Report a Problem".

  • Is there a way to undo "autofill" so that all the songs, artists, albums, etc on my iPod touch 4th gen coincide/are synchronized again?

    I don't know if you can help me, but I erroneously clicked on "auto fill" under the "on this ipod" category of the itunes screen that's located on my desktop.  As a result, all the songs, albums, artists, etc., are now out of sync, don't coincide with one another, and when I touch a song to play on my ipod touch (fourth generation) it flips to a different artist/song and plays it automatically.  Is there any way I can undo this, and if so, how?   This occurred while I was purchasing/downloading music onto my iPod, and the usb cord was plugged into the modem at the time.  Any suggestions/advice offered to solve this problem would be much appreciated. 

    - Unsync/delete all music and resync
    To delete all music go to Settings>General>Usage>Storage>Music>Tap edit in upper right and then tap the minus sign by All Music
